Q1. [1] § 11.4 OHM'S LAW § 11.5 FACTORS ON WHICH THE RESISTANCE OF A CONDUCTOR DEPENDS § 11.6 RESISTANCE OF A SYSTEM OF RESISTORS
In case of four wires of same material, the resistance will be minimum if the diameter and length of the wire respectively are
  1. A D/2 and L/4
  2. B D/4 and 4L
  3. C 2D and L
  4. D 4D and 2L

Model Answer

Option D: 4D and 2L

Using $R = \rho \dfrac{l}{A} = \rho \dfrac{l}{\pi d^2/4}$, resistance is minimum when length is minimum and diameter is maximum. Option D (diameter = 4D, length = 2L) gives the largest diameter and a relatively short length, hence minimum resistance.
